Transaction 570bc8fcb4275eefeab2b03ef029d248219b7039d77687a22345f29383c50f8f
1 Input
2 Outputs
- 570bc8fcb4275eefeab2b03ef029d248219b7039d77687a22345f29383c50f8f:0
- 570bc8fcb4275eefeab2b03ef029d248219b7039d77687a22345f29383c50f8f:1
value 10000000
address 2Mw8C6KmgbfmRC6r9S1qUcwAjzvmogW71Rz
value 99995520
address miHCTSsFVPGmUTVmd4tXfzcZAyD2cNhEHL